I Write Artist Statements

An artist-run writing service for your website, press outreach, residency and fellowship applications, and more.

0
Your Cart

Что такое SQL и как с ним функционировать

Что такое SQL и как с ним функционировать

SQL выступает собой средство организованных инструкций для администрирования сведениями в реляционных базах данных. Средство позволяет генерировать таблицы, включать записи, изменять данные и стирать ненужную данные. SQL применяют девелоперы, аналитики, управляющие баз данных и тестировщики.

Инструмент действует через команды, которые передаются системе управления базами данных. Команды записываются текстом по заданным принципам синтаксиса. Система получает запрос, исполняет инструкцию и выдаёт результат.

Работа с SQL стартует с освоения базовых инструкций для отбора и корректировки данных. Новички осваивают инструкции SELECT, INSERT, UPDATE и DELETE. Практика деятельности с On X способствует укрепить умения и понять принцип создания инструкций.

SQL характеризуется описательным методом к разработке. Пользователь определяет нужный ответ, а система автономно выбирает вариант реализации команды. Подобный подход упрощает создание инструкций для неопытных профессионалов.

Для чего требуется SQL

SQL задействуется для содержания и анализа упорядоченной сведений в коммерческих и некоммерческих проектах. Инструмент гарантирует мгновенный подключение к миллионам данных и позволяет осуществлять статистические операции над данными.

Веб-магазины задействуют SQL для администрирования каталогами продуктов, анализа покупок и фиксации остатков. Финансовые системы содержат данные о заказчиках, операциях и депозитах в реляционных базах. Социальные сети применяют язык для работы с профилями клиентов и постами.

Аналитики onx добывают данные из баз для формирования сводок и обнаружения закономерностей. SQL позволяет агрегировать параметры, вычислять средние значения и объединять информацию по признакам. Маркетологи оценивают поведение заказчиков с помощью запросов к базам данных.

Девелоперы создают приложения, которые коммуницируют с базами через SQL. Интернет-сервисы направляют команды для получения данных и отображения содержимого. Мобильные программы сверяют информацию с серверами.

Как построены базы данных и таблицы

База данных представляет собой организованное место хранения сведений, состоящее из связанных таблиц. Каждая таблица хранит сведения об определённой объекте: клиентах, товарах, покупках или транзакциях. Построение базы создаётся с учётом бизнес-требований и характеристик тематической области.

Таблица состоит из записей и колонок, имитируя компьютерную таблицу. Столбцы определяют характеристики сущностей и обозначаются полями. Строки включают конкретные записи с данными об индивидуальных элементах сущности. Каждое поле содержит определённый вид данных: численный, текстовый, дата или булевый.

Основной ключ однозначно выделяет каждую элемент в таблице. Обычно первичным ключом является численное поле с неповторимыми величинами. Вторичные ключи создают отношения между таблицами и гарантируют целостность сведений в базе.

Основные составляющие построения таблицы включают:

  • Наименование таблицы, отражающее хранимую элемент
  • Набор полей с обозначением типов данных
  • Ограничения для надзора корректности заносимой данных
  • Индексы для повышения скорости нахождения данных

Нормализация базы данных ликвидирует повторение сведений и группирует информацию по категориальным таблицам. Процедура нормализации соответствует установленным принципам, называемым стандартными формами. Грамотная архитектура On-X облегчает обслуживание и повышает быстродействие системы.

Диаграмма базы данных наглядно отображает таблицы и отношения между ними. Графики содействуют понять логику формирования информации и создать оптимальную организацию. Взаимодействие с On X нуждается осознания правил организации реляционных схем данных.

Главные операторы для работы с сведениями

SELECT получает сведения из таблиц базы данных. Инструкция даёт возможность обозначить желаемые колонки и условия выборки строк. Инструкция выдаёт ответ в форме комплекта элементов, удовлетворяющих требованиям инструкции.

INSERT создаёт дополнительные записи в таблицу. Оператор нуждается указания названия таблицы и параметров для внесения полей. Можно включить единственную элемент или ряд элементов за одну команду. Система анализирует соответствие информации форматам полей перед добавлением.

UPDATE изменяет существующие строки в таблице. Оператор обеспечивает возможность модифицировать величины одного или нескольких полей. Критерий WHERE указывает, какие элементы подлежат модификации. Без определения условия оператор скорректирует все строки в таблице.

DELETE убирает записи из таблицы по заданному критерию. Команда необратимо удаляет сведения, поэтому требует осторожного применения. Критерий WHERE задаёт, какие строки необходимо удалить.

CREATE TABLE генерирует новую таблицу с установленной структурой полей. Оператор определяет имена колонок, виды данных и правила. DROP TABLE окончательно уничтожает таблицу вместе со всем наполнением. Познание Он Икс Казино вырабатывает фундаментальные компетенции управления информацией в реляционных механизмах хранения.

Отбор, упорядочивание и классификация строк

Критерий WHERE выбирает данные по указанным условиям. Инструкция обеспечивает возможность извлечь записи, удовлетворяющие конкретным величинам полей. Можно задействовать инструкции сопоставления и булевы действия AND, OR, NOT для формирования сложных условий. Фильтрация Reduces количество предоставляемых данных.

ORDER BY упорядочивает итоги выборки по одному или ряду столбцам. Оператор поддерживает упорядочивание по возрастанию и уменьшению значений. Сортировка строк облегчает исследование информации и обнаружение требуемых величин.

GROUP BY группирует записи с одинаковыми параметрами в определённых полях. Группировка используется совместно с агрегирующими функциями для вычисления общих параметров. Методы COUNT, SUM, AVG, MIN и MAX рассчитывают количество строк, итоги, средние значения, минимумы и наибольшие значения.

HAVING выбирает итоги после группировки данных. Параметр задействуется к суммированным значениям и позволяет отобрать категории, отвечающие заданным условиям по вычисленным величинам.

Команды LIKE и IN увеличивают варианты выборки строк. LIKE выполняет нахождение по шаблону с подстановочными элементами. IN анализирует присутствие величины в список альтернатив. Верное применение On-X повышает производительность исследовательских инструкций.

Как связываются информация из отличающихся таблиц

JOIN соединяет данные из нескольких таблиц на основе соединений между ними. Операция обеспечивает возможность получить информацию, разнесённую по разным таблицам, в единственном итоговом множестве. Отношение создаётся через общие поля, обычно основной и связующий ключи.

INNER JOIN выдаёт исключительно те строки, для которых обнаружены пересечения в обеих таблицах. Элементы без совпадения удаляются из результата. Этот тип соединения задействуется, когда нужны сведения, присутствующие синхронно в связанных таблицах.

LEFT JOIN содержит все элементы из левой таблицы и идентичные записи из правой. Если пересечение отсутствует, поля правой таблицы заполняются величинами NULL. Оператор применяется для получения полного списка записей из ведущей таблицы.

RIGHT JOIN работает обратным способом, оставляя все строки правой таблицы. FULL OUTER JOIN предоставляет все строки из обеих таблиц, наполняя недостающие величины NULL.

CROSS JOIN формирует декартово произведение таблиц, комбинируя каждую запись первой таблицы с каждой записью второй. Вложенные запросы обеспечивают возможность использовать итог единственного команды внутри другого. Изучение On X и понимание механизмов связывания таблиц увеличивает возможности взаимодействия с Он Икс Казино в составных базах данных.

Типичные проблемы, которые выполняют с посредством SQL

Формирование сводок образует существенную долю работы с базами данных. Аналитики получают информацию о сделках, заказчиках и денежных показателях за установленные интервалы. Запросы агрегируют сведения и группируют итоги по категориям для демонстрации руководству.

Выявление дубликатов помогает обеспечивать точность сведений в системе. Команды определяют дублирующиеся элементы по ключевым полям: email, телефон или уникальный номер. Нахождение копий обеспечивает возможность привести в порядок базу и избежать ошибки.

Трансфер данных между структурами требует выгрузки сведений из одной базы и внесения в иную. SQL предоставляет экспорт данных в необходимом виде и импорт сведений с преобразованием структуры.

Определение числовых параметров производится через агрегирующие методы и группировку данных. Специалисты определяют усреднённый счёт потребителя, конверсию воронки продаж и тенденцию увеличения клиентской базы.

Контроль правами подключения ограничивает варианты участников по деятельности с сведениями. Администраторы устанавливают разрешения на просмотр, корректировку и устранение информации для отличающихся функций. Реальное использование On-X покрывает обширный спектр проблем от анализа до обслуживания платформ.

Ошибки, которых нужно обходить в старте деятельности

Отсутствие критерия WHERE при корректировке или стирании строк приводит к корректировке всех элементов в таблице. Начинающие пропускают обозначить критерий отбора и ошибочно модифицируют информацию, которые должны сохраниться неизменными. Перед исполнением операторов UPDATE и DELETE необходимо проконтролировать критерий фильтрации.

Пренебрежение индексов замедляет обработку команд к большим таблицам. Обнаружение без индексов заставляет систему просматривать все элементы поочерёдно. Формирование индексов для регулярно используемых колонок ускоряет процедуры извлечения сведений в десятки раз.

Стандартные ошибки неопытных работников охватывают:

  • Задействование SELECT * вместо перечисления необходимых полей, что повышает нагрузку на систему
  • Отсутствие запасного копирования перед объёмными модификациями сведений
  • Хранение паролей и конфиденциальной данных в явном формате
  • Пренебрежение правил непротиворечивости при проектировании таблиц

Ошибочное задействование форматов данных ведёт к чрезмерному расходу дискового объёма. Выбор текстового поля значительного объёма для хранения коротких величин нецелесообразен. Каждый формат данных обладает эффективную сферу использования и условия.

Игнорирование транзакциями при выполнении взаимосвязанных команд нарушает целостность сведений. Если одна из инструкций заканчивается ошибкой, ранние изменения остаются в базе. Транзакции предоставляют атомарность выполнения набора команд.

Копирование инструкций без понимания логики деятельности порождает трудности при корректировке кода. Изучение Он Икс Казино нуждается осознанного подхода и изучения итогов реализации команд.

Leave a Reply

Your email address will not be published. Required fields are marked *